What is an AWS SOC?

An AWS SOC (Security Operations Center) job involves monitoring, detecting, and responding to security threats within an AWS cloud environment. Professionals in this role analyze security incidents, manage alerts, and implement defensive strategies to protect cloud-based infrastructure and data. They work with security tools like AWS Security Hub, GuardDuty, and CloudTrail to identify vulnerabilities and mitigate risks. Strong knowledge of cloud security best practices, incident response, and compliance frameworks is essential.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the AWS SOC position, and why are they important?

To excel as an AWS SOC (Security Operations Center) analyst, you need a deep understanding of cloud security protocols, incident response, and threat detection, often supported by a degree in information security and relevant AWS certifications such as AWS Certified Security – Specialty. Proficiency in using cloud-native security tools (e.g., AWS GuardDuty, CloudTrail, Security Hub), SIEM platforms, and automation scripts is essential. Strong analytical thinking, effective communication, and the ability to stay calm under pressure are valuable soft skills in this position. These competencies enable swift identification, mitigation, and reporting of cyber threats in complex cloud environments, helping organizations maintain strong security postures.

What are some common challenges AWS SOC analysts face in their day-to-day work?

AWS SOC analysts often manage a high volume of security alerts and must quickly distinguish between genuine threats and false positives. They also face the dynamic challenge of staying updated on the latest cloud vulnerabilities and evolving attack vectors unique to AWS environments. Effective collaboration with IT, development, and compliance teams is frequently required to implement timely mitigation actions. While this can be demanding, it offers a fast-paced work environment where problem-solving and continuous learning are highly valued.

Is AWS SOC an entry level job?

An AWS Security Operations Center (SOC) role is typically not entry-level and usually requires prior experience in cybersecurity, network monitoring, or related fields. Candidates often need knowledge of security tools, incident response, and certifications like CompTIA Security+ or CISSP. Entry-level positions in cybersecurity may involve supporting SOC analysts or assisting with basic security tasks.

Job description

Zachary Piper Solutions is seeking a SIEM Engineer to join a leading client in the cybersecurity and defense industry in the RTP area. The SIEM Engineer role is a hybrid position requiring onsite presence on Tuesdays and Thursdays. The SIEM Engineer is best suited for a security professional with strong Splunk expertise, AWS exposure, and experience in SOC or incident response environments who thrives in a fast-paced, mission-driven setting.

Responsibilities of the SIEM Engineer include:

• Engineer and enhance Splunk Enterprise Security detections, dashboards, and correlation searches to strengthen threat visibility

• Build and support automation workflows and playbooks within Splunk SOAR to streamline response efforts

• Integrate and normalize diverse security data sources into Splunk while ensuring data quality and performance optimization

• Partner with SOC and engineering teams to refine detection capabilities and improve operational efficiency across the environment

• Lead and support incident investigations, coordinating response actions and contributing to continuous monitoring coverage

Requirements of the SIEM Engineer include:

• Active Secret Clearance

• 3+ years of experience in SIEM engineering, SOC operations, or incident response

• Advanced proficiency with Splunk, including writing complex SPL queries and building production-grade dashboards (similar to Ashley Brown-level experience)

• Experience integrating AWS services (such as AWS Security Hub) and other security tools into a centralized SIEM platform

• Strong understanding of data onboarding, CIM normalization, and Splunk knowledge objects, with the ability to operate in high-pressure environments

• Ability to work onsite twice weekly in RTP – Tuesday and Thursday
